Mike- I'm wondering if there's a little confusion here. The Chicago & Eastern Illinois was absorbed into the Missouri Pacific during 1976. By any chance were you thinking of the Monon Railroad? It went into the L&N. Track maps potential source: http://trainsite.8m.com Usually on the pricey side. Reproduction quality spotty. But probably the largest collection available. Boxcab E50
Yeah, as Matthew mentioned the Eastern portion between Woodland Jct and Evansville was absorbed by the L&N while the MoPac took the Western portion from Woodland Jct to St. Louis.
